Specialist Disability Accommodation (SDA) Home – Christie Downs, SA Christie Down Address: 14 Barnabas Crescent, Christie Downs, SA

Property Type: Platinum Standard SDA – High Physical Support

About the Home This brand-new, purpose-built SDA home is designed to provide the highest level of accessibility, comfort, and safety for individuals with complex support needs. Located in the well-connected community of Christie Downs, the home offers a peaceful environment while being close to essential services, shopping centres, and public transport.

Key Features

Platinum SDA Design – fully accessible for high physical support needs 3 spacious bedrooms with individual ensuites and ceiling hoist provisions Wide doorways and step-free access throughout the home Modern open-plan kitchen and living areas designed for easy mobility Assistive technology-ready, including smart home capability 24/7 on-site overnight support room for staff Fully fenced, landscaped outdoor area for safe enjoyment

Location Highlights

5 minutes to Colonnades Shopping Centre Close to Christie Downs Train Station and bus services Access to local healthcare, Allied Health services, and community facilities

Who is this home suitable for? This home is ideal for NDIS participants with SDA funding for High Physical Support or Fully Accessible design categories. It’s perfect for someone seeking:

A vibrant, community-based living model More independence in a safe, supportive environment Long-term accommodation with tailored supports

Support Model This property is part of the Orion Care community model, providing person-centred Supported Independent Living (SIL) services, with a focus on dignity, independence, and building meaningful connections.
